Reference specification
| Item | Value |
|---|---|
| Model | Mint Plus |
| Brand | Al Fakher |
| Category | Flavours |
| Battery | 650 mAh |
| Output range | 5-80 W |
| Capacity | 1.2 ml |
| Charging | USB-C fast charge |
| Coil options | 0.4 / 0.6 ohm |
| Carton quantity | 120 units |

Checklist
- Review the reorder point after one full selling cycle.
- Request batch photographs and a packing list prior to shipment.
- Record the arrival condition with photographs on the day of delivery.
- Verify that artwork matches the approved compliance template.
- Log sell through by account for the first eight weeks.
- Agree in advance who pays for return freight on a defect claim.

Frequently asked questions
How long does a Mint Plus battery typically last per charge?
Most devices in this class deliver a full day of moderate use, with charging time around forty to sixty minutes.
Can packaging be adjusted for our market?
Artwork localisation is straightforward; structural changes need larger volumes and a longer lead time.
How quickly can a repeat order be produced?
For established configurations production typically runs two to four weeks, with transit on top depending on the chosen method.
Can several models be mixed in one shipment?
Yes, mixing models and flavours within a carton or pallet is common and usually helps first time buyers test demand.
